I'm starting to think about antenna work this summer and one of the items on my list of improvements is my 160M capability. I have 2 150' towers on my property that are 192' apart and lined up at about a 39 degree azimuth. I was planning on building a phased array of inverted L's 255' apart (1/2 wl spacing). Another thought is to do 2 groundplanes with the feed point at about 50' and 4 elevated radials. Pros/Cons? Could I get away with 192' spacing and call it good?
